What is the difference between Entry Level Architect vs Junior Architect?
| Aspect | Entry Level Architect | Junior Architect |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or's degree in architecture, internship experience | Bachelor's degree, internship or similar experience |
| Work Environment | Design firms, architecture studios, construction sites | Design teams, project sites, architectural firms |
| Responsibilities | Assist in design, drafting, research, basic project tasks | Support senior architects, prepare drawings, coordinate projects |
Both roles typically require a bachelor's degree in architecture and internship experience. Entry Level Architects often handle initial design tasks and research, while Junior Architects support senior staff with drafting and project coordination. The titles are used interchangeably in some firms, but 'Entry Level Architect' emphasizes a formal entry point into the profession, whereas 'Junior Architect' may imply a slightly lower or more support-focused role.
What does an entry level architect do?
As an entry-level architect, your job is to help create conceptual designs for each project at your firm. In this role, you may help design a landscape, create structures that meet the commercial or residential needs of the client, or prepare architectural assessments. Entry-level architects frequently produce design drawings, use physical and digital art to convey ideas, and receive mentoring from senior-level architects. Many companies use this position as a form of additional training, so learning and developing your skills may be among your most important tasks. You also support senior architects, ensure all projects adhere to the company's standards of practice, and help answer questions for clients.

Job Description
We are seeking a talented Naval Architect ready to apply practical engineering skills to design new vessels, develop modifications to improve existing vessels, navigate an increasingly complex regulatory framework, and help clients solve unique problems in marine environments.
We are looking for candidates who:
- Are passionate about the maritime industry.
- Thrive in a culture of collaboration, innovation, and integrity.
- Embrace a philosophy of client service by solving real-world problems clients face in the maritime industry, supporting their best interests and building lasting partnerships through reliable service and dependable solutions.
- Are motivated to identify and pursue internal and external professional growth opportunities, including areas outside their specific discipline.
- Demonstrate excellent written, verbal, and graphical communication.
Responsibilities:
- Apply specific technical knowledge of hydrostatics, stability, and structural analyses.
- Understand and apply knowledge of the maritime regulatory guidance, field work (shipchecking and shipboard systems performance surveys), shipyard practices, and contract specifications.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Naval Architecture or equivalent experience with a background in marine structures, hydrostatics, and hydrodynamics.
- Engineer-in-Training certification is preferred.
- Familiarity with AutoCAD, Rhino3D, GHS, Python, and Microsoft Office software packages.
- Excellent communication skills. Communication is a highly valuable skill at Glosten, as we frequently collaborate in inter-disciplinary teams and must convey complex ideas clearly and concisely to clients and other project stakeholders.
- Strong technical writing, teamwork abilities, time management, and problem solving skills.
- Must be authorized to work in the United States. Due to project restrictions, Glosten will only consider applicants with unrestricted access to work in the United States or those eligible for TN visas.
- Some travel and fieldwork are required. Some project assignments may require a valid driver's license, TWIC card, and/or current passport.
- This position is based in one of our office locations (Seattle, WA; Bellingham, WA; or Providence, RI).
